The Netherlands Potassium Alum Market has shown a significant growth trajectory. The peak market size of €1.23 million in 2030 is forecasted, with steady growth observed from €0.01 million in 2020 to €0.26 million in 2024. Notable spikes in market size occurred in 2023 and 2029, driven by increasing demand for potassium alum in various industries. The market experienced a slight downturn in 2024 due to a marginal growth rate but quickly rebounded. The CAGR for 2022-24 was 98.58%, reflecting a period of rapid expansion, while the CAGR for 2025-30 is projected at 30.0%, indicating sustained growth. In the Netherlands Potassium Alum Market, exports exhibited a fluctuating pattern over the years, with a peak in 2022 at approximately €52.38 thousand, followed by a decline in 2023 to around €9.7 thousand before slightly recovering in 2024 to about €14.32 thousand. Conversely, imports experienced a substantial increase from roughly €43.52 thousand in 2019 to approximately €354.86 thousand in 2023, marking a notable peak, and then decreased to about €90.61 thousand in 2024. In 2025, exports and imports were recorded at about €10.77 thousand and €86.15 thousand, respectively. The fluctuations in exports can be attributed to global demand variations, changes in production capacities, and market competitiveness. The surge in imports in 2023 could be linked to increased raw material requirements for domestic production or strategic inventory buildup.
